github - 在使用http协议时,git clone操作需要进行输入密码验证吗?
本文介绍了github - 在使用http协议时,git clone操作需要进行输入密码验证吗?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
问 题
我在Github官方的帮助手册上看到了这句话:
When you
git clone
,git fetch
,git pull
, orgit push
to a remote repository using HTTPS URLs on the command line, you'll be asked for your GitHub username and password.
当你在命令行中使用HTTPS的URL来对远程仓库进行git clone
,git fetch
,git pull
, 或者git push
操作时,你会被要求输入Github的用户名和密码。
但是实际上我在git clone
(使用http协议)从来没遇到过要求输入用户名和密码,难道是帮助文档写错了吗?
NOTE:本问题源于本站的另一个问题,我在回答其他人的问题时,突然想到了这个问题。
解决方案
如果项目是开源的,那么执行git clone
的时候是不需要输入用户名或者密码阿德,只有在修改项目之后提交代码的时候才会要求输入账号密码。
这篇关于github - 在使用http协议时,git clone操作需要进行输入密码验证吗?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!
查看全文